The Mike & Juliet Show was mostly an attack on Liquid Trust. The manufacturer refuses to say how much oxytocin is in the product, but it won't get into your body - or anyone else's -- if you spray it on your clothes or even skin.
There are plenty of ways to experience a natural oxytocin release without buying anything. In my book (The Chemistry of Connection, April 2009) I explain the oxytocin response, why we don't all have a healthy one, and talk about ways of building it up.
But all of us do have a hypothalamus and all of us do release oxytocin; without it, we'd die. To get the social benefits, try one or more of the following. If you can, set aside at least 15 minutes to do this and nothing else:
- Cuddle
- Sing in a choir
- Hold a baby
- Stroke a dog or cat
- Perform a generous act
- Pray
- Make love
- Have an orgasm (alone or with someone else)

The dose they use in the trust experiments is 400 IU; IU are not the same as units/ml, and I am unclear on the math.
An oxytocin nasal spray is available via doctor's prescription in the UK, Canada and probably other countries, but not in the US. If you live in a country where it's available, you might be able to find a doc or psychiatrist willing to prescribe it for this off-label use.
You should be aware that the effects are mild. Usually, in the experiments, subjects can't tell whether they got oxytocin or placebo, even though it tends to affect their behavior. It's unclear how long the effects last. Experiments infusing oxytocin into the blood stream showed effects lasting several weeks, but none of the intranasal experiments have followed up with subjects.
The illegal drug ecstasy has also been shown to release oxytocin, that's probably why people report that feeling of deep connection with others.
If you can't get oxytocin through a doctor, I highly recommend you experiment with provoking a natural release in your brain. Many of the techniques I listed above have been shown in studies to evoke the oxytocin response. You can train your brain to do this!
